After seven rounds over three days, the judges decided Tenzin Khechoe (22) from Bengaluru as the Ist Runner-up, while Tenzin Nordron (20) from Chauntra in Mandi district of Himachal was adjudged the 2nd Runner-up. The winner got a cash prize of Rs 1 lakh while the first and 2nd runners-up were given Rs 50,000 and Rs 25,000 respectively. Netizens also favoured Tenzin Paldon for the Miss Photogenic title, with 5,161 (36%) out of a total 14,285 votes. The winner and the 1st runner-up also won a two-week trip to Vietnam, sponsored by Claire Huynh Hong Hai.
Paldon said that a pageant like Miss Tibet gives young women a platform to help them become independent and strong. She hopes to inspire and influence the younger Tibetan generation to be determined, honest, and dedicated. Miss Tibet Pageant was introduced in 2002 by Lobsang Wangyal Production. The three-day event had seven rounds, included swim suit, talent and talk and traditional costume. In a surprise move, Director Lobsang Wangyal announced that this year’s Pageant was his last, saying he has organised it for 15 years.
Summer Festival Enthralls Queen Of Hills
Himachal This Week, Shimla
Singers Madhuri Pandey, Rajeev Thapa and other pahari singers strewed the magic of their voices. Thakur Das Rathi, Geeta Bhardwaj, Lokender Chauhan, Muskan Thakur and Dilip Simauri were also in the list who mesmerised the audience with their captivated music. A fashion show, painting competition and other programmes were also part of the Summer Festival. Folk dance festival at Gaiety Theatre, food festival at Ashiana Restaurant, baby show and dog show at The Ridge were applauded by visitors. Kuchipudi dance item was also highlight of this biggest event. On the last evening of the programme, Sultana sisters created a hypnotic atmosphere, where music lovers were spellbound.
